当前位置:首页 > 即时通讯 > 正文

即时通讯传输协议的简单介绍

简述信息一览:

IM的功能讲解

1、IM的功能主要包括以下几点:实时信息交流:IM支持文字、文件、图片、语音等多种形式的实时信息传递,使得用户能够迅速与他人进行沟通。消息可靠性:即时通讯关注消息送达的可靠性,即便存在延迟,只要最终能送达,用户通常可以接受。这种特性保证了信息传递的稳定性。

2、IM的功能主要包括即时信息传递、文件传输、图片分享、语音对话以及***通话等。即时信息传递:这是IM最基本的功能,允许用户实时发送和接收文字消息,确保沟通的即时性和有效性。文件传输:用户可以通过IM应用发送和接收各种类型的文件,如文档、图片、音频和***等,极大地方便了工作和学习中的资料共享。

即时通讯传输协议的简单介绍
(图片来源网络,侵删)

3、IM的功能主要包括以下几点:即时信息传递:IM支持文字、文件、图片、语音等多种信息的即时传递,使得用户能够迅速与他人进行沟通。多平台支持:IM通过诸如腾讯QQ、微信、钉钉等应用广泛融入人们生活,这些应用支持多种设备平台,如手机、电脑等,方便用户在不同设备上使用。

4、IM的全称为即时通讯,是一种利用网络技术实现实时交流的工具。以下是关于IM的详细介绍:功能特点:即时性:允许用户在短时间内发送文字信息、文件、语音甚至***,实现即时沟通。在线状态感知:提供实时的在线状态信息,用户能清楚地知道联系人是否在线,便于立即进行交流。

5、IM即Instant Messaging的缩写,中文可译为即时通讯。在抖音平台上,IM权限允许用户通过抖音的聊天功能与其他用户进行实时的交流。这种交流可以是文字、语音或***形式,为用户提供了丰富的沟通方式。

即时通讯传输协议的简单介绍
(图片来源网络,侵删)

一文搞懂WebSocket介绍,与Socket的区别

WebSocket与Socket的关系在于Socket并不是一个协议,而是应用层与TCP/IP协议族之间的接口。Socket提供了一组接口,使得应用程序可以使用TCP或UDP进行通信。WebSocket是一种应用层协议,实现了全双工通信,类似于Socket协议。WebSocket是HTML5标准的一部分,支持跨语言和跨框架使用。

MQTT、WebSocket和Socket是三种不同的网络通信协议,各自具有独特的特点和应用场景。MQTT: 应用场景:主要用于解决传感器与控制设备在低带宽、不可靠网络环境下的通信问题。 通信模型:***用发布/订阅模式,确保消息传输的一对多特性,且对负载内容进行屏蔽。

socket.io在此基础上,通过封装WebSocket,满足了所有场景需求,同时,与WebSocket相比,socket.io添加了报文类型、命名空间和ack ID等元数据。SSE作为单向通信协议,特别适用于股票行情、新闻推送等场景,提供了更高的效率。通过分析SSE的数据帧格式、通信过程及使用示例,本文还强调了兼容性问题和潜在的缺点。

WebSocket/Socket.io通信:与HTTP不同,WebSocket/Socket.io允许双向、持续通信。客户端和服务端可以互相发送数据,而无需每次都发起新的HTTP请求。这种方式特别适用于需要实时数据传输或频繁交互的场景。

Websocket协议简介 Websocket协议是一种双向通信协议,相比于HTTP的非持久化特性,它具有持久连接和实时传输的优势。在HTTP协议中,每一次请求和响应构成一次完整的会话,而Websocket在建立连接后,服务器和客户端都能主动向对方发送信息,就像Socket通信一样。

XMPP定义

1、XMPP,全称为可扩展通讯和表示协议,是一项用于实时通讯、表示和需求响应服务的XML数据元流式传输协议。它源于1999年Jabber开源社区,Jabber是即时通讯领域中广泛***用的开放式协议。

2、XMPP的前身是Jabber,一个开源形式组织产生的网络即时通信协议。XMPP目前被IETF国际标准组织完成了标准化工作。标准化的核心结果分为两部分; 核心的XML流传输协议 基于XML流传输的即时通讯扩展应用 XMPP的核心XML流传输协议的定义使得XMPP能够在一个比以往网络通信协议更规范的平台上。

3、XMPP协议通过TCP/IP协议传输XML流,它定义了客户端、服务器和***三个角色。客户端与服务器之间通过TCP连接,客户端向服务器发送XML格式的即时通讯指令,服务器则负责处理这些指令,进行用户信息的管理和消息的转发。***负责与其他即时通讯系统进行交互,比如短信系统、MSN和ICQ等。

4、XMPP(Extensible Messaging and Presence Protocol)是开源即时通信协议,用于网络即时通信。

5、是一种轻量级、发布-订阅模式的消息传输协议,适合物联网通讯,***用订阅/发布模式管理设备间消息。MQTT-SN是MQTT协议的传感器版本,运行在UDP上,保留大部分信令和特性。NB-IoT(窄带物联网)协议用于设备接入互联网,与LoRaWAN类似。XMPP(可扩展通讯和表示协议)是开源即时通信协议,用于网络通信。

6、XMPP协议则是一种基于XMPP即时通讯协议的开源协议,它允许用户通过统一的客户端访问多种即时通讯服务。XMPP协议具有高度可扩展性和灵活性,支持多种应用层协议。尽管PRIM不再被广泛使用,但IMPP、SIMPLE和XMPP协议在即时通信领域发挥着重要作用,为用户提供更加便捷和灵活的沟通方式。

mqtt与socket的区别

MQTT与Socket的区别如下:设计目的与应用场景:MQTT:专为工作在低带宽、不可靠网络的远程传感器和控制设备通讯而设计。它适用于物联网环境,特别是在机器与机器通信、智能家居及小型化设备中已广泛使用。Socket:作为HTML5中的一种协议,它主要用于实现浏览器与服务器之间的全双工通信。

mqtt与socket的区别有:mqtt协议是为工作在低带宽、不可靠网络的远程传感器和控制设备通讯而设计的协议,而WebSocket则是为了浏览器与服务器全双工通信的一种协议。mqtt是IBM开发的一个即时通讯协议,有可能成为物联网的重要组成部分。Socket是HTML5一种新的协议。

mqtt与socket的区别主要有:mqtt协议是为计算能力有限,并且在低带宽、不可靠网络下工作的远程传感器、控制设备通讯而设计,而WebSocket则是为了浏览器与服务器全双工通信而设计;mqtt是IBM开发的即时通讯协议,而Socket是基于TCP的一种应用层网络协议。

MQTT、WebSocket和Socket是三种不同的网络通信协议,各自具有独特的特点和应用场景。MQTT: 应用场景:主要用于解决传感器与控制设备在低带宽、不可靠网络环境下的通信问题。 通信模型:***用发布/订阅模式,确保消息传输的一对多特性,且对负载内容进行屏蔽。

综合而言,MQTT、WebSocket和Socket各有侧重,分别适用于消息传递、双向通信与网络连接需求。MQTT适用于传感器与控制设备的通信,WebSocket服务于浏览器与服务器间的实时交互,Socket则提供TCP/IP协议的接口,支持各种传输层协议的通信。

请教各位大侠,im即时通信开发原理

即时通讯(Instant Messenger,简称IM)软件多是基于TCP/IP和UDP进行通讯的,TCP/IP和UDP都是建立在更低层的IP协议上的两种通讯传输协议。前者是以数据流的形式,将传输数据经分割、打包后,通过两台机器之间建立起的虚电路,进行连续的、双向的、严格保证数据正确性的文件传输协议。

您提到的移动通信TD信令流程,通常指的是TDS-CDMA网络中Iu接口的信令流程。这个接口包括Iu-CS接口和Iu-PS接口,相关的协议可能包括Ranap等。整个信令流程涵盖了从呼叫建立、会话管理到释放的全过程。

有两个方案,一个是空闲时间来确定,一个是起始字符来确定:1,空闲时间,通过SMW90来设置空闲时间,假如SMW90设置为200MS,那么如果现在距离上次接收消息等于或者超过200毫秒,PLC就开始处于接收状态,具体怎么接收和处理,可以参见上一段。

有线通信和无线通信的基本原理是一样的,只不过传输介质不同(电缆、光纤或无线电)工作流程:目前通信的主要是数字信号,也就是一组0、1。发射时首先对其进行编码(比如纠错编码,提高可靠性),出来的仍然是数字信号,然后进行调制变成数字基带信号(比如QPSK),再变成模拟信号(通过DA或DDS)。

关于即时通讯传输协议和的介绍到此就结束了,感谢你花时间阅读本站内容,更多关于、即时通讯传输协议的信息别忘了在本站搜索。